Monica was born March 26, 1924 in Jackson County at Otter Creek, Iowa, the daughter of Michael and Ella (Malone) Ryan. She attended St. Lawrence Grade School in Otter Creek, Iowa and in 1943, she graduated from Zwingle High School. Following high school graduation, Monica moved to Dubuque and was employed by the Dubuque Telephone Company. She met her husband LuVerne Boge, at the St. Patrick's Dance at Center Grove dance hall in 1947. On September 1, 1948 they married at St. Patrick's Catholic Church in Dubuque, Iowa. Together they farmed south of the Boge homestead from 1949 until retiring in the early 1990's. LuVerne preceded her in death on May 19, 2007. Her most enjoyable occasions were times spent with family and playing bingo. Highlights of her life were the trips she and her husband took to visit their son and his family in Australia.
